Abstract

Image dehazing algorithm can restore a hazed image back to a haze-free image. Dark channel prior (DCP) is an efficient technique to estimate an airlight owing to its effectiveness. However, DCP causes considerable computation burdens, limiting its hardware efficiencies. To overcome this limitation, a smooth DCP (SDCP) technique is proposed in this study. The experimental results show that this study can save computation burdens by 70.9% with a minor loss of 1.03% on the accuracy of airlight estimation. Consequently, this study can greatly reduce computation burdens of DCP while keeping an accurate airlight estimation.
